I recently spotted this article from ABCNews that discusses the present and future of Sun Microsystems, the writer compares the company's fate with that of Digital (DEC), once the 2nd largest computer company in the world.

Despite of past success, present revenues (which are on a declining trend though) and an on-going campaign to boost the company presence and its products, it's truth that the future of the company depends completely on how well they can keep up with technological changes.

Although a bit exagerated for my taste, the writer mentions important facts such as the number of Sun executives who have left the company in the recent years and the decadence of million-dollar servers.
